Choosing the right tubular battery involves more than checking capacity. Let me share the essential points you must consider:
Before buying any inverter battery, calculate how much load you want to support. Are you powering basic lights and fans? Or do you also need to run TVs, routers, laptops, and small appliances?
Your load directly determines the battery capacity you should choose. For example, homes usually need a battery between 120Ah and 220Ah, while small offices may require higher capacities.
The Ah rating indicates how long the battery can deliver power. Higher Ah means longer backup. A 150Ah tubular battery is good for moderate load, while a 200Ah battery is suitable for heavier usage.
Don’t just buy a bigger battery—match the Ah rating with your inverter’s capacity and your energy needs.

A strong warranty is a sign of trust. Tubular batteries typically come with 36 to 60 months of warranty. Longer warranties indicate better performance and reliability.
Tubular batteries need periodic topping up of distilled water (unless you choose maintenance-free types). If you prefer a no-maintenance option, select a battery specifically labeled as maintenance-free.
Not all batteries are compatible with every inverter. Always match:
Battery voltage
Battery capacity (Ah)
Inverter charging current
A mismatch can reduce battery life and affect backup time.

1. Is a tubular battery better than a flat plate battery?
Yes, tubular batteries last longer, perform better in high temperatures, and handle deep discharges more efficiently.
2. What is the ideal Ah rating for home use in Yemen?
Most homes use 150Ah–200Ah tubular batteries depending on their load and backup needs.
3. Do tubular batteries need regular maintenance?
Yes, unless you choose a maintenance-free model. Regular distilled water topping improves performance.
4. What are the disadvantages of a tubular battery?
Disadvantages of Tubular Batteries:
Higher Initial Cost: One notable drawback is the higher upfront cost compared to flat plate batteries. ...
Weight and Size: Tubular batteries are often heavier and larger than their flat plate counterparts, making them less suitable for applications with space or weight constraints.
5. How long does a tubular inverter battery last?
With proper care, tubular batteries can last 4–7 years, depending on usage and environmental conditions.
